Kawhi’s Game 7 Bounce is Now a Punchline After Raptors-Clippers Trade Freeze

Remember when Kawhi Leonard’s Game 7 shot against the Sixers bounced on the rim about nine times before dropping? That hesitation is basically a perfect metaphor for what’s happening with his trade now.

The NBA world found out this week that the Clippers and Raptors have put their massive Kawhi deal on ice. The reason? That Aspiration investigation has finally caught up to the situation, and Toronto isn’t exactly eager to absorb whatever penalties might come with it.

Toronto’s position is pretty straightforward. They were ready to bring Kawhi back for another title run, but apparently they learned that completing the trade would mean inheriting any fallout from the NBA’s investigation into whether the Clippers used the now-defunct company Aspiration to get around salary cap rules. The Raptors reportedly said no thanks to assuming that risk.

So naturally, social media did its thing. JE Skeets dropped the obvious joke on X: “Kawhi trade gonna bounce on the rim a few times.” Because of course it did. That’s basically the theme of Kawhi’s entire career at this point — nothing happens cleanly.

For those who need a refresher on why that shot still lives rent-free in everyone’s head: 2019 Eastern Conference Semifinals, Game 7, the ball hangs in the air forever, bounces four times, and finally falls through. The Raptors won the title that year. Fans in Toronto were hoping for a repeat when news broke that the team was trying to bring Kawhi back. Now they’re stuck waiting.

What the Aspiration Investigation Actually Means

Sports journalist Pablo Torre first reported that the NBA had been quietly looking into whether Leonard and the Clippers used Aspiration — a company that’s no longer in business — to basically hide money and get around the salary cap. This isn’t some minor procedural thing either. The league has precedent for handing out serious punishments for this kind of stuff, including suspensions and losing draft picks.

It’s not hard to see why Toronto would pump the brakes. Taking on Kawhi’s contract is one thing. Taking on a potential penalty package from the league is another thing entirely.

As of now, there’s no timeline on when the NBA will wrap up its investigation. The trade sits in limbo. And Kawhi, who might be the most stoic superstar in league history, is presumably just waiting it out somewhere quiet.

The Raptors fans who were already planning the parade route might want to hold off on those reservations.
